The Beauty of Trichomes: "Curly Fuzz" Tea
Locals affectionately call this tea "Juan Mao Mao Cha" (Curly Fuzz Tea). Look closely at our unretouched images: the silvery white hairs (trichomes) coating each leaf are a hallmark of authenticity. These tiny structures are rich in amino acids and aromatic compounds, essential to the tea's signature floral fragrance and complex umami. Their presence is a testament to the immense manual labor required—Bi Luo Chun is one of the few teas that defies machine harvesting.
The Heritage Varietal: Qunti Xiaoye Zhong
Our Classic Spring Harvest is sourced from the traditional Qunti variety—the very same heirloom tea trees officially recognized by the Imperial court centuries ago. While modern clones offer higher yields, the native "Late Tea" provides a deeper, more solid aromatic foundation. Each 500g of dry tea requires tens of thousands of precise hand-pickings, ensuring that only the most tender buds reach your cup.

Brewing Perfection
80°C - 85°C (176°F - 185°F)
Gentle heat protects the delicate, downy buds.
"Top-Drop"
Pour water first, then add leaves to watch them sink.
3g | 150ml
Ideal for highlighting the layered floral depth.
